An ancient Greek colony (apoikia) in southwestern Sicily. Today it is Agrigento, Italy. It was founded around 580 BC by citizens of Gela, and flourished under the tyrants Phalaris and Theron in the 6th and 5th centuries BC. The ruins of the Archaic temples on the Acropolis belong to this period, and the philosopher Empedocles was also from this city. In Roman times it was called Agrigentum, and although it suffered a great blow in the Punic Wars, it was rebuilt and has survived to the present day as one of the major cities of Sicily. However, its area is not as large as it was in ancient Greece. Source: Encyclopaedia Britannica Concise Encyclopedia About Encyclopaedia Britannica Concise Encyclopedia Information |
